    I am hopefully finishing week 4 today. I was able to do day w4d2 on Wednesday, so I know I can do it again today. There is a group here on mfp for c25k-ers which I found helpfull and inspirational. I would suggest signing up for a 5K now for around your completion date, it gives you a goal. I am signed up for one in June and an obstacle one in July. It helps knowing I have to push through to reach my goals and I left enough time between when I "should" end my program and the races so I could repeat a coule of weeks if needed. And if I don't need to repeat weeks, then I have time to get stronger and try to improve my time.

    Go slow and listen to your body, but know that your body is most likely stronger than you think. The best advice I took from the c25k board was that my mind would give up before my body would. I pushed through a tough spot and they were right.

    Good luck.

    Just finished week 5 day 2... but yes the first 3 weeks I found pretty easy, week four kicked my butt but I pushed through and so far week 5 has been great! We'll see how day 3 goes on Monday, I'm a little worried about that one... I used the easier runs to work on increasing my pace so that as they get tougher I can maintain a better pace. If it's too easy push harder! Before I started, I was doing minimal running (15min or less at a time) and struggling around 5.3mph, now a slow pace for me is 6.0mph :smile: Good luck!
